Senator Ireti Kingibe, representing the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), has openly raised concerns about Minister Nyesom Wike’s approach to governance, accusing him of bypassing established legal procedures while performing his duties.

Speaking on Channels Television’s Politics Today on Wednesday night, Kingibe acknowledged some visible achievements, including infrastructure improvements, but maintained that consistent oversight and adherence to the rule of law remain lacking.

She cited her own experience, explaining that a letter she sent to Wike praising the rehabilitation of Kunene Close was misinterpreted as political endorsement. “That letter was simply to appreciate the repair of a road that had long been abandoned — not because it was my personal street,” she clarified.

Kingibe emphasized that her critiques stem from her legislative responsibilities, not personal animosity. “The minister has made some positive efforts, but many times he does not follow the rule of law. It’s my responsibility to point out where he falls short. None of this is personal,” she stated.

The senator further criticized the absence of regular consultations between the FCT minister and elected officials. She contrasted Wike’s approach with previous ministers, who reportedly held monthly meetings to address community concerns and collaborate on solutions. “It’s almost three years since he assumed office, and I have never sat with him in any formal engagement,” Kingibe lamented, noting ongoing challenges such as security issues and poor waste management.

Despite her frustrations, Kingibe expressed hope that improved cooperation between Wike and lawmakers will emerge in the coming year, emphasizing that coordinated governance is essential for the well-being of FCT residents.
